Work and play at MD&M East

MD&M East opens this morning, June 9th 2015, at the Jacob K. Javits Convention Center in New York City.

Event producer UBM Canon says it is welcoming visitors who are attending the largest advanced design and manufacturing event on the East Coast, where there will be hundreds of exhibitors showcasing their new products, technologies and services.

On the centre stage today there will be a comprehensive schedule of serious talks, such as, 10 Ways Innovation, Design, Demographics, and Global Trends will Affect Healthcare in 10 years; and How to Avoid Common Design Mistakes in Prototyping. However, interspersed between the serious content there will be presentations such as the 3D Materials Girl of NYC and a 3D printed drone.

Professor Pythagoras will be conducting an engineering trivia game, “Do you Science?” tomorrow and there will also be company presentations from Toxikon Corporation, Nelson Laboratories, CI Medical Technologies, Scissent, and CADD Edge on the show floor. At 4pm tomorrow there will be an announcement and ceremony for the winners of the Medica Design Excellence Award 2015, (MDEA) and John Abele, Boston Sceintific Cofounder, will be honoured with this year’s Lifetime Achievement Award.

Guided Innovation Tours will be lead by experts, across the three days, who will point out the latest technology and industry trends across the exposition hall. Today’s tour focuses on robotics, tomorrow’s tour will investigate 3D printing and digital health and Thursday’s tour will feature innovative suppliers.

There is a full slate of conference sessions happening throughout the event; 3-day MD&M East Conference, 3-Day HBA Global Conference, 2-Day Pharmapack North America Conference, 2-Day Integrated Quality Management Course, 1-Day Industrial Automation: Advancing the Smart Plan, 1-Day Innovations in 3D Printing Conference.

Eastman Chemical Company will also be turning one booth into a bating cage, where attendees will be invited to take a swing at a plastic mug, to see if they can break it.
